The way we approach card balance in Clash Royale is a combination of playtesting and looking at the stats – in particular, card use rates and win rates. You can expect monthly balance changes to keep gameplay fine tuned and as fun as possible.<\/p>\n
In this round of balance changes we’re taking a look at a few underused cards: Mirror, Rage, Lightning – and some other nice little tweaks!<\/p>\n
Giant: Damage decreased by 5%<\/b>
\n– The Giant will still hit hard after this change – he has really big fists after all<\/i> – we just wanted to take a little bit of power from his offensive capabilities, as his main role is to soak up damage.<\/p>\nRage: Elixir cost decreased to 2 (from 3), effect decreased to 30% (from 40%), duration decreased by 2sec<\/b>
\n– The Rage spell hasn’t seen much usage and is in need of a bigger change, especially with the introduction of the Lumberjack’s “free” Rage. Decreasing the Elixir cost to 2 should make Rage a really viable and exciting combo card!<\/p>\nLumberjack: Rage effect decreased to 30% (from 40%), Rage duration decreased by 2sec<\/b>
\n– For consistency with the Rage spell changes above.<\/p>\nMirror: Mirrors cards 1 level higher than its own level<\/b>
\n– We love the surprise element Mirror brings and we’ve been having a blast playtesting this new version! At Tournament Rules card levels, Mirror will bring a truly unique element to your deck, making your cards 1 level higher than the tournament cap! Also, a max level Mirror will create max level +1 cards!<\/p>\nLightning: Stuns targets for 0.5sec<\/b>
\n– Due to Lightning’s low use rate, and partly for consistency with Zap, we’re adding a brief stun effect to make it more unique and hopefully an interesting addition to some decks.<\/p>\nThe Log: Knocks back ALL ground troops<\/b>
\n– This change will make The Log feel<\/i> like the Legendary Card it was born to be.<\/p>\nBomber: Hitpoints decreased by 2%, Damage increased by 2%<\/b>
\n– A small tweak to fix a couple of inconsistencies with card interactions at certain levels.<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"New Balance Live!
